Transaction 156ddc13d95c9b1625890b7e2bdde87e76ee317d5957bc14eb2505e8b76cd9f5

1 Input
2 Outputs
  • 156ddc13d95c9b1625890b7e2bdde87e76ee317d5957bc14eb2505e8b76cd9f5:0
  • value  51509
    address  33jSo4kgNKPgq2ZZLQ73R339nuRwkHQt8N
  • 156ddc13d95c9b1625890b7e2bdde87e76ee317d5957bc14eb2505e8b76cd9f5:1
  • value  16411785
    address  1FRZKQuks6wa31pQo3sFhWDDKwf24fbyUL